The invention relates to a high-altitude operation platform set up on a high-rise building. The high-altitude operation platform comprises a platform surface, support legs supporting the platform surface, a static friction plate disposed at the end of each support leg, a fixing rod for fixing the relative position of each support leg and the platform surface, and lock catches preventing the platform surface from tipping over outwardly, wherein one end of each support leg is in pin connection with the platform surface, and the other end thereof is in pin connection with the corresponding static friction plate; an adjustable included angle alpha is formed between each support leg and the platform surface, and alpha is not larger than 30 degrees; the position of each fixing rod is fixed, the length of each fixing rod is adjustable, and each fixing rod is provided with a locking device for locking the adjusted length of the fixing rod.
